ProcessProtocol counter-implementation: all methods on this class raise an exception, so instances of this may be used to verify that only certain methods are called.

Method outReceived Some data was received from stdout.
Method errReceived Some data was received from stderr.
Method inConnectionLost This will be called when stdin is closed.
Method outConnectionLost This will be called when stdout is closed.
Method errConnectionLost This will be called when stderr is closed.

Inherited from ProcessProtocol:

Method childDataReceived Called when data arrives from the child process.
Method childConnectionLost Called when a file descriptor associated with the child process is closed.
Method processExited This will be called when the subprocess exits.
Method processEnded Called when the child process exits and all file descriptors associated with it have been closed.

Inherited from BaseProtocol (via ProcessProtocol):

Method makeConnection Make a connection to a transport and a server.
Method connectionMade Called when a connection is made.
